引言
在人工智能技术快速迭代的背景下,大模型的性能与功能升级成为开发者关注的核心。某主流云服务商近期对其第三代大模型Qwen3进行了全面技术升级,从架构设计到应用场景均实现了突破性进展。本文将从技术架构、多模态能力、推理效率及安全性四个维度展开分析,并提供可落地的开发实践建议。
一、架构优化:混合专家模型(MoE)的深度应用
Qwen3代引入了更高效的混合专家模型(Mixture of Experts, MoE),通过动态路由机制将输入分配至不同专家子网络,显著提升了计算资源利用率。
-
技术亮点:
- 专家子网络细分:将模型参数拆分为多个专家模块(如语言理解、逻辑推理、常识知识等),每个模块针对特定任务进行优化。
- 动态门控机制:通过轻量级门控网络(Gating Network)实时计算输入与各专家的匹配度,避免无效计算。例如,对于数学推理问题,门控网络会优先激活逻辑推理专家。
- 稀疏激活策略:每次推理仅激活少量专家(如2-4个),在保持模型规模的同时降低计算开销。
-
开发实践建议:
- 参数调优:根据业务场景调整专家数量与激活比例。例如,对话类应用可增加语言理解专家权重,而数据分析类应用侧重逻辑推理专家。
- 硬件适配:MoE架构对GPU并行计算能力要求较高,建议使用支持张量并行(Tensor Parallelism)的硬件环境,或通过模型分片(Model Sharding)降低单卡内存压力。
二、多模态能力升级:跨模态理解与生成
Qwen3代突破了传统文本模型的局限,支持文本、图像、语音的多模态交互,其核心在于跨模态注意力机制(Cross-Modal Attention)的优化。
-
技术实现:
- 统一编码器:通过共享的Transformer编码器提取文本、图像、语音的隐式表示(Latent Representation),实现模态间语义对齐。
- 多模态解码器:支持生成式任务(如根据文本描述生成图像)与理解式任务(如图像标注、语音转写)的统一处理。
- 数据融合策略:采用渐进式融合(Progressive Fusion)方法,先在低维空间对齐模态特征,再在高维空间进行交互,避免信息丢失。
-
代码示例(伪代码):
```python多模态输入处理示例
from transformers import AutoModelForMultiModal
model = AutoModelForMultiModal.from_pretrained(“qwen3-multimodal”)
inputs = {
“text”: “描述一张海边日落的图片”,
“image”: load_image(“sunset_beach.jpg”), # 假设存在图像加载函数
“audio”: load_audio(“wave_sound.wav”) # 假设存在音频加载函数
}
output = model(**inputs) # 输出跨模态融合结果
```
- 应用场景建议:
- 智能客服:结合语音识别与文本理解,实现自然对话。
- 内容创作:根据文本描述生成配图或视频片段。
- 无障碍技术:将图像内容转换为语音描述,辅助视障用户。
三、推理性能提升:量化与硬件加速
Qwen3代通过模型量化与硬件优化,将推理延迟降低40%,同时保持精度损失小于2%。
-
关键技术:
- 4位量化(INT4):将模型权重从FP32压缩至INT4,减少内存占用与计算量。
- 动态批处理(Dynamic Batching):根据输入长度动态调整批处理大小,避免短输入导致的计算资源浪费。
- 硬件感知优化:针对主流GPU架构(如NVIDIA Hopper)优化算子实现,提升张量核心利用率。
-
性能对比数据:
| 模型版本 | 推理延迟(ms) | 内存占用(GB) | 精度损失(BLEU) |
|—————|————————|————————|—————————|
| Qwen2 | 120 | 8.5 | - |
| Qwen3 | 72 | 5.2 | 1.8% | -
部署建议:
- 量化工具选择:使用开源量化库(如TensorRT-LLM)进行后训练量化(PTQ),避免从头训练的高成本。
- 批处理策略:对实时性要求高的场景(如在线对话),设置固定小批处理(如batch_size=8);对离线任务(如文档分析),采用动态批处理以最大化吞吐量。
四、安全性增强:数据隐私与模型鲁棒性
Qwen3代在数据安全与模型抗攻击能力方面进行了全面升级。
-
技术措施:
- 差分隐私(DP)训练:在训练过程中添加噪声,防止通过模型输出反推训练数据。
- 对抗训练(Adversarial Training):通过生成对抗样本(如添加扰动后的文本)提升模型鲁棒性。
- 访问控制:支持细粒度权限管理,例如限制特定用户对敏感功能(如金融分析)的调用。
-
安全开发实践:
- 数据脱敏:在预处理阶段对敏感信息(如身份证号、电话号码)进行掩码处理。
- 模型监控:部署异常检测系统,实时监控输入输出中的恶意内容(如诱导性提问)。
五、开发者生态支持:工具链与社区
Qwen3代提供了完整的开发者工具链,包括模型微调框架、评估基准及社区支持。
-
工具链组成:
- 微调框架:支持LoRA(低秩适应)等高效微调方法,减少训练数据量与计算成本。
- 评估套件:涵盖多模态任务(如VQA、文本生成)的标准化评估指标。
- 社区论坛:提供技术问答、案例分享及版本更新通知。
-
最佳实践案例:
- 医疗问答系统:通过LoRA微调,在少量医疗数据上实现高精度诊断建议生成。
- 教育辅助工具:结合多模态能力,开发支持图文互动的智能教辅应用。
结论
某主流云服务商Qwen3代的全面升级,通过架构创新、多模态融合、性能优化及安全增强,为开发者提供了更高效、灵活、安全的AI开发平台。开发者可根据业务需求,灵活选择模型功能与部署方案,同时借助完善的工具链与社区支持,快速实现技术落地。未来,随着大模型技术的持续演进,Qwen系列有望在更多垂直领域展现其技术价值。